Transaction 3f9eea58fb2fd93e7ffa6592d6ae2e7472160bdc915bdf96b5b1d44dd90ddd09

300 Input
1 Outputs
  • 3f9eea58fb2fd93e7ffa6592d6ae2e7472160bdc915bdf96b5b1d44dd90ddd09:0
  • value  72705307
    address  33oqVzKYXk2UiEiEEDR37gCbs7BjCXtTt3